Set the installation directory path. It is highly recommended to use the default root path (usually C:\ADCDA2\ ) rather than installing it into C:\Program Files\ . Legacy software struggles with the restricted write-permissions native to the modern Program Files directory structure.
AutoData 340 needs the Microsoft Visual C++ 2010 Redistributable libraries. If you are on a 64‑bit Windows, install both the x86 and the x64 version.
